What is the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C)?

The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C) is a structured process used by developers and project managers to design, develop, test, and deploy software applications. It consists of several phases, typically including planning, analysis, design, implementation, testing, deployment, and maintenance. SDLC helps ensure that software is developed systematically, meets user requirements, and is delivered on time and within budget. By following SDLC methodologies, organizations can improve the quality and efficiency of their software development projects.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als working in a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C) role, and how can they be addressed?

Professionals involved in the SDLC often face challenges such as communication gaps between cross-functional teams, managing changing project requirements, and ensuring timely delivery while maintaining quality. These challenges can be addressed by adopting agile methodologies, using robust project management tools, and promoting regular collaboration among developers, testers, and stakeholders. Clear documentation and continuous feedback loops also help in aligning the team's efforts and adapting to changes efficiently.

Responsibilities:
  • The RSA Archer Administrator will be responsible for customizing client implementation of RSA Archer based upon business requirements provided by stakeholders.ย 
  • The Archer Administrator will use their previous Archer project experience and RSA best practices to take the Archer out of the box use cases and advise stakeholders of the amount of customization required and when the out of the box use case can be used as-is.ย 
  • The Archer Administrator shall develop, test, and deploy Archer applications in clientย  development, test, and production environments using RSA Archer packaging mechanisms.
  • ย The Archer Administrator will be familiar with or shall become familiar with the Archer use cases owned by client to ensure that the Agency takes full advantage of its investment in RSA Archer.ย 
  • The candidate should be highly organized, can work independently in a fast-paced environment, and produce multiple quality deliverables with varying deadlines.ย 
  • The candidate should be a self-starter and creative problem solver with the flexibility to learn new products and technologies quickly.
Essential Responsibilities:
  • Collaborating with client stakeholders in applying process and functional requirements to application design modifications.
  • Providing design and development of reporting dashboards and iViews to client stakeholders.
  • Integrating data feeds into Archer.
  • Working with clientย  stakeholders configuring and/or customizing RSA Archer 6.x
  • Implementing RSA Archer out of the box as well as leading design and analysis for customizations and On Demand applications for client Stakeholders
  • Possessing strong analytical and problem-solving skills in application calculations and cross references
  • Being responsible for day-to-day technical administration of the RSA Archer platform
  • Leading the administration of items such as user accounts, data feeds, workflow, and report access.
  • Providing development/configuration support based on technical requirements.
  • Owning technical issues, problem resolution, and request management.
  • Provisioning of Archer local user accounts and assigning groups and roles.
  • Having previous experience working with Archer LDAP integration with Active Directory.
